  ![Sarah Carignan Arbelaez](/sites/default/files/styles/large/public/Sarah%20Arbelaez_56_2x3.jpg?itok=dKhz5_5e)#### Sarah Carignan Arbelaez, MBA

 SVP, Hospital Integration; Interim President, Boston Medical Center – South

 

 

 
 

 Sarah Carignan Arbelaez oversees BMC Health System's integration process with BMC Brighton and BMC South, in addition to overseeing emergency management, public safety, and support services for BMC.

Prior to joining BMC in 2012, Arbelaez worked in administrative and financial roles at Mass General Brigham, HealthMETRICS Partners, and Hartford Financial Services. From 2021 to 2023, she also served as adjunct faculty at Harvard Medical School, co-directing a course in clinical operations management and workflows. She earned her Master of Business Administration from Duke University’s Fuqua School of Business and her Bachelor of Arts in psychology from Brandeis University.

  ![Ravin Davidoff, MBBCh](/sites/default/files/styles/large/public/Ravin%20Davidoff%20recropped%202%202x3.jpg?itok=xhPjNref)#### Ravin Davidoff, MBBCh

 Executive Medical Director and Clinical Integration Lead

 

 

 
 

 Ravin Davidoff, MBBCh, oversees Boston HealthNet and clinical partnerships at Boston Medical Center, including the integration of BMC Brighton and BMC South.

Prior to 2022, Dr. Davidoff served as chief medical officer and senior vice president of medical affairs at BMC. He earned his Bachelor of Medicine, Bachelor of Surgery (MBBCh) from the University of Witwatersrand Medical School and completed his residency and served as chief resident in internal medicine at Boston City Hospital before completing a cardiology fellowship at Massachusetts General Hospital.

  ![Headshot of Anthony (Tony) Hollenberg, MD, President, BMC & System Chief Physician Executive of Boston Medical Center Health System (BMCHS)](/sites/default/files/styles/large/public/Standard%20JPG-250731_Tony%20Hollenberg_Headshot_2x3.jpg?itok=OFTsZuP6)#### Anthony Hollenberg, MD

 President, BMC &amp; System Chief Physician Executive

 

 

 
 

 Anthony (Tony) Hollenberg, MD, oversees strategic leadership across the academic medical center as BMC models a new kind of excellence in healthcare where clinical and operational innovation meets health equity and access.

Before being appointed to this role in 2024, Dr. Hollenberg served as physician-in-chief at Boston Medical Center and the John Wade Professor and Chair of the Department of Medicine at Boston University Chobanian &amp; Avedisian School of Medicine. He has also spent 30-plus years assuming progressive leadership positions in academic medicine at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center and Massachusetts General Hospital, before spending four years as the chair and chief of the Department of Medicine at NewYork-Presbyterian/Weill Cornell. Dr. Hollenberg is a nationally recognized physician-scientist who specializes in endocrinology. His work has focused on thyroid disorders and investigating the physiological and molecular mechanisms by which thyroid hormones regulate metabolism, including body weight, as well as thyroid gland development.

Dr. Hollenberg received a medical degree from University of Calgary, and he completed his residency in internal medicine at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center, followed by a clinical and research fellowship at Massachusetts General Hospital. Dr. Hollenberg received a Bachelor of Arts in biochemical sciences from Harvard College. He currently serves as treasurer of the American Thyroid Association and the Association for Professors of Medicine.

  ![Paul Smith, MS](/sites/default/files/styles/large/public/Paul%20Smith_BMC_9_9_7_2x3.jpg?itok=b0gdu9Hd)#### Paul Smith, MS

 President, BMC Brighton

 

 

 
 

 Paul Smith oversees the strategy and operations of Boston Medical Center – Brighton. He is responsible for the delivery of exceptional, compassionate care to thousands of patients, maintaining the highest levels of quality and patient experience.

Prior to this role, Smith served as the hospital’s chief operating officer and helped lead the response to the COVID-19 pandemic. Previously, he also served as the Chief Operating Officer for Saint Vincent Hospital in Worcester. He received his master’s degree in healthcare management from University of Massachusetts Lowell and his bachelor’s degree from Saint Anselm College.
